They got married on February 8, 1928 at Overveen, Nederland, he was 25 years old.


Child(ren):

  1. Duke Draaisma  1929-1940
  2. (Not public)

The couple were divorced from May 29, 1941 at Overveen, Nederland.


(2) He is married to Wilhelmina Josina Henriette Koopman.

They got married on August 4, 1941 at Voorburg, Nederland, he was 38 years old.
